Cronache di Cervia

Cervia was founded by the Etruscans as a salt-trading port, and the vast salt pans still define its economy and skyline. In the Middle Ages it was controlled by the archbishops of Ravenna, who rebuilt it inland after the original site was abandoned due to malaria. Its current modern grid of low-rise hotels and pizzerias dates to the 1950s beach tourism boom, when the salt flats were partly turned into a nature reserve. Today Cervia is quieter than neighbouring Milano Marittima, retaining a dignified, workaday atmosphere — think pensioners promenading in deckchairs and locals arguing over the best piadina. The city’s contemporary identity is split between sustainable salt production and family-friendly seaside leisure, with a slow summer pulse.

Il momento migliore per visitare

Guida completa di Cervia →

I migliori mesi

June and September: sea temperatures are warm (22-25°C), sun is reliable, and the July-August crush hasn’t started or has already ebbed; you get the full beach experience without queueing for a sunbed.

Peak / Festival Surge

July and especially the first half of August, when Italian families descend for the Ferragosto holiday (15 August). Hotel prices double or triple, and the coast is packed with day-trippers from Bologna and Ravenna. The main event is the weekly Wednesday market on the lungomare, but the real driver is simply the national summer exodus.

Stagione di spalla

Late May and the second half of September: room rates drop by 30-40%, the water is still swimmable, and the pine-scented cycling paths are blissfully quiet. You’ll share the beach with retired couples and a few kite-surfers.

Meteo e imballaggio

Cervia’s climate quirk is the ‘ora’ — a strong, cool sea breeze that kicks up most afternoons between 2pm and 5pm, even on cloudless days. Pack a light windbreaker for the beach and a thin long-sleeved shirt for evening al fresco dinners, as the breeze can feel chilly after sunset.

Tipping etiquette

Tipping in Italy is generally less common than in the US, but rounding up the bill or leaving 1-2 euros for good service is considered sufficient. For hotel staff, 1-2 euros per bag for porters and 1-2 euros per day for housekeeping is customary.
